A bounding box search algorithm for DEM simulation

被引:11
|
作者
Walizer, Laura E. [1 ]
Peters, John F. [1 ]
机构
[1] USA, Res & Dev Ctr, Vicksburg, MS 39180 USA
关键词
Algorithm theory; Contact search; Discrete element; Particle size; Polydisperse; CONTACT DETECTION ALGORITHM; SIZES;
D O I
10.1016/j.cpc.2010.09.008
中图分类号
TP39 [计算机的应用];
学科分类号
081203 ; 0835 ;
摘要
In Discrete Element Method (DEM) simulations, the most costly operation performed by the program in terms of CPU time is often the process of identifying which pairs of particles are potentially in contact. Program performance can especially be degraded when the relative size difference between the smallest and largest discrete elements is greater than a factor of 2 to 5. Recently, particle-based searches with a hierarchy of cell spaces were proposed to eliminate the size-dependence problem (Peters et al. (2009) [1]), He et al. (2007) PI. Both methods allowed the cell size to be based on the diameter of the smallest particles, and the methods were found to be effective. In this paper, the authors evaluate the performance of a related but simpler algorithm dubbed the 'bounding box search method'. The bounding box method entails identifying all cells which any part of a target particle may occupy, listing the target particle as present in those cells, and searching for potential contacts over the same set of cells (the 'bounding box'). Where the hierarchy methods improve performance by creating multiple cell spaces based on particle sizes, the bounding box method uses only a single cell space, but allows the cell size to be based on the smallest particles, rather than the largest. To evaluate the performance of the bounding box algorithm, timed simulations were performed on systems with varying numbers of particles and particle size distributions, and runtimes were compared to identical systems simulated using a so-called 'basic' search algorithm, which places a target particle in a single cell and searches over all neighboring cells. Results presented herein show the bounding box approach to yield improved performance relative to the simple search method for most systems, especially those with the largest numbers of particles and least uniform size distributions. The effect of selected cell size is also examined, and it is shown that cell sizes between one and two times the smallest particle diameter yielded the best performance. Published by Elsevier B.V.
引用
收藏
页码:281 / 288
页数:8
相关论文
共 50 条
  • [1] An improved contact detection algorithm for bonded particles based on multi-level grid and bounding box in DEM simulation
    Huang, Peng
    Ding, Yifei
    Miao, Qiuhua
    Sang, Gao
    Jia, Minping
    [J]. POWDER TECHNOLOGY, 2020, 374 : 577 - 596
  • [2] Simulation-based analysis of Bounding Box localization algorithm for Wireless Sensor Network
    Wu, Peng
    Su, Shaojing
    Guo, Xiaojun
    [J]. GLOBAL INTELLIGENCE INDUSTRY CONFERENCE (GIIC 2018), 2018, 10835
  • [3] Application of Collision and Interference Inspection Algorithm Based on Bounding Box in NC Machining Simulation
    Li, Jing
    Jiao, Yan
    Li, Bingyi
    [J]. ADVANCED MANUFACTURING TECHNOLOGY, PTS 1-3, 2011, 314-316 : 501 - +
  • [4] Study On Collision Detection Algorithm of Hybrid Bounding Box
    Tu Chaoqiang
    Yu Lizhen
    [J]. 2009 INTERNATIONAL FORUM ON INFORMATION TECHNOLOGY AND APPLICATIONS, VOL 2, PROCEEDINGS, 2009, : 190 - 192
  • [5] Box length search algorithm for molecular simulation of systems containing periodic structures
    Schultz, AJ
    Hall, CK
    Genzer, J
    [J]. JOURNAL OF CHEMICAL PHYSICS, 2004, 120 (04): : 2049 - 2055
  • [6] A minimum bounding box algorithm and its application to rapid prototyping
    Chan, CK
    Tan, ST
    [J]. SOLID FREEFORM FABRICATION PROCEEDINGS, AUGUST 1999, 1999, : 163 - 170
  • [7] Research on Bounding Box-tree Algorithm for Collision Detection
    Xiong, Yumei
    Chen, Yimin
    Chen, Yihao
    [J]. NEW TRENDS AND APPLICATIONS OF COMPUTER-AIDED MATERIAL AND ENGINEERING, 2011, 186 : 645 - +
  • [8] Efficient Similarity Search on 3D Bounding Box Annotations
    Kriegel, Hans-Peter
    Petri, Marisa
    Schubert, Matthias
    Shekelyan, Michael
    Stockerl, Michael
    [J]. MEDICAL IMAGING 2012: ADVANCED PACS-BASED IMAGING INFORMATICS AND THERAPEUTIC APPLICATIONS, 2012, 8319
  • [9] Calculation Method for Grading Size and Grading Bounding Box of Virtual Aggregate Based on DEM
    Zhou, Zhigang
    Ling, Jun
    [J]. MATHEMATICAL PROBLEMS IN ENGINEERING, 2021, 2021
  • [10] Collision Detection Based on Bounding Box for NC Machining Simulation
    Wang, Yao
    Hu, Yan-juan
    Fan, Jiu-chen
    Zhang, Yu-feng
    Zhang, Qi-jiu
    [J]. INTERNATIONAL CONFERENCE ON APPLIED PHYSICS AND INDUSTRIAL ENGINEERING 2012, PT A, 2012, 24 : 247 - 252